Julian Brazier has been the Conservative MP for Canterbury since 1987.[1]
Brazier's parliamentary career has included periods as: Opposition Whip (Commons) 2001-02; Shadow Minister (Work and Pensions) 2002-03; Shadow Minister (Home Affairs) 2003-03; Shadow Minister (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s) 2003-05; and Shadow Minister (Transport) 2005-10.[1] He was appointed as a Parliamentary Under Secretary of State at the Ministry of Defence in July 2014.[2]
